renamed auth
Autenticazione OAuth sicura. Le Sue credenziali non toccano mai la cronologia della shell o le variabili d'ambiente.
renamed auth <command>Il comando auth gestisce l'autenticazione utilizzando il flusso OAuth per dispositivi. Apre il Suo browser per un accesso sicuro — nessuna chiave API da copiare o segreti da esporre.
I token vengono memorizzati criptati nel portachiavi del Suo sistema (macOS Keychain, Linux libsecret, Windows Credential Manager), non in file di testo normale.
Sottocomandi
loginAutenticati con il Suo account renamed.to tramite browser (flusso OAuth per dispositivi).
tokenMemorizza un token API manualmente. Utile per ambienti CI/CD.
logoutRimuovi le credenziali memorizzate dal portachiavi.
whoamiVisualizza l'utente attualmente autenticato.
statusControlla lo stato dell'autenticazione e i crediti rimanenti.
refreshAggiorna manualmente un token scaduto.
Esempi
Accedi (apre il browser):
$ renamed auth login
Apertura del browser per l'autenticazione...
In attesa dell'approvazione...
✓ Autenticato con successo come alex@example.comControlla lo stato e i crediti rimanenti:
$ renamed auth status
Connesso come: alex@example.com
Token scade: 2026-02-08 14:30:00
Crediti rimanenti: 847Accesso senza interfaccia grafica (browser non disponibile):
$ renamed auth login --no-open
Visiti questo URL per l'autenticazione:
https://renamed.to/device?code=ABCD-1234Memorizza un token manualmente (CI/CD):
$ renamed auth token --token rnt_abc123...
✓ Token memorizzato con successoControlla con quale account sei connesso:
$ renamed auth whoami
alex@example.comEsci:
$ renamed auth logout
✓ Disconnesso con successoOpzioni di Login
--no-openNon aprire automaticamente il browser. Visualizza un URL da visitare su un altro dispositivo.
--client-id <id>ID client OAuth personalizzato per SSO aziendale.
--client-secret <secret>Secret client OAuth personalizzato per SSO aziendale.
--scope <scopes>Elenco separato da virgole di scope OAuth da richiedere.
Opzioni Token
-t, --token <token>Il token API da memorizzare.
-s, --scheme <scheme>Schema di autorizzazione (predefinito: Bearer).
--non-interactiveNon richiedere input. Esci con errore se il token manca.
Memorizzazione Token
macOS — Keychain Access
Linux — libsecret (GNOME Keyring, KWallet)
Windows — Credential Manager
Variabili d'Ambiente
RENAMED_TOKEN — Token API per l'autenticazione (alternativa a auth token)
RENAMED_CLIENT_ID — ID client OAuth personalizzato per SSO aziendale
RENAMED_CLIENT_SECRET — Secret client OAuth personalizzato per SSO aziendale
Suggerimenti
Prima dell'installazione come servizio — Esegua sempre renamed auth login prima di renamed service install. Il servizio necessita di credenziali memorizzate per funzionare.
Server senza interfaccia grafica — Utilizzi --no-open su server senza display. Copi l'URL e si autentichi da qualsiasi dispositivo con un browser.
Ambienti CI/CD — Utilizzi la variabile d'ambiente RENAMED_TOKEN o il comando auth token.
Scadenza token — I token si aggiornano automaticamente. Se visualizza errori di autenticazione, esegua renamed auth refresh o acceda nuovamente.